To be fair, the teenager who started the Oregon wildfires probably won’t have to pay the full $37 million. But, he will have to make payments for the next decade. And, if he complies and stays out of trouble, after 10 years the restitution payments will stop.

Earlier this year, the 15-year-old from Washington admitted throwing two fireworks in Eagle Creek Canyon. The fires spread quickly and caused evacuations, highway shutdowns and ruined tons of land.

Although, the kid’s lawyer said the $37 million was “absurd” which I kind of agree with. But again, if he does well he won’t have to pay it all. And he caused massive devastation via the Oregon wildfires to beloved land and the people who lived there.
